ADB下载安装及全面使用指南

作者:4042024.12.03 02:22浏览量:642

简介:本文详细介绍了ADB(Android Debug Bridge)的下载、安装过程,以及其在Android设备调试、应用管理、数据传输等方面的全面使用方法,帮助开发者高效进行Android应用开发与调试。

ADB(Android Debug Bridge)是Android开发者工具箱中的核心工具,它允许开发者与连接的Android设备进行通信,执行调试和管理任务。下面将详细介绍ADB的下载安装及使用过程。

一、ADB的下载安装

1. 下载ADB工具

  • 官方渠道:访问Android开发者官网,下载最新的SDK Platform Tools,其中包含了ADB工具。确保下载的版本与操作系统兼容。
  • 第三方平台:也可以在一些可信的第三方软件下载平台,如CSDN等,搜索并下载ADB工具。但需注意,务必从官方或可信渠道下载,以避免安全风险。

2. 安装ADB工具

  • Windows系统
    1. 将下载的SDK Platform Tools压缩包解压到一个易于访问的文件夹中,例如“C:\adb”。
    2. 将解压后的adb.exe所在目录添加到系统的环境变量中。具体操作为:右键点击“我的电脑”,选择“属性”,点击“高级系统设置”,再点击“环境变量”,在“系统变量”中找到“Path”,点击“编辑”,然后添加adb.exe所在目录。
  • Mac和Linux系统
    通常可以通过包管理器(如Homebrew、APT)直接安装ADB工具。

3. 验证安装

  • 打开命令提示符(CMD)或终端,输入“adb version”命令,查看ADB工具的版本信息,以验证是否安装成功。

二、ADB的使用

1. 连接设备

  • 使用USB数据线将Android设备连接到计算机。
  • 在Android设备上,进入“设置”>“关于手机”,连续点击“版本号”数次以启用开发者选项。
  • 返回上一级菜单,进入“开发者选项”,开启“USB调试”。
  • 在命令提示符(CMD)或终端中输入“adb devices”命令,查看设备是否被正确识别。

2. 应用管理

  • 安装应用:使用“adb install ”命令安装APK文件。
  • 卸载应用:先使用“adb shell pm list packages”查看所有已安装应用的包名,然后使用“adb uninstall <包名>”命令卸载应用。

3. 数据备份与恢复

  • ADB还支持数据备份和恢复功能,用户可以通过命令行备份应用数据,方便在更换设备时恢复使用。

4. 系统调试

  • 查看日志:使用“adb logcat”命令可以实时查看Android设备的日志输出,这对于调试应用非常有帮助。
  • 进入设备shell环境:通过“adb shell”命令,可以进入设备的shell环境,执行Linux命令,如查看文件、修改权限等。

5. 文件传输

  • 上传文件:使用“adb push <本地文件路径> <设备目标路径>”将文件从电脑传输到设备。
  • 下载文件:使用“adb pull <设备文件路径> <本地目标路径>”将文件从设备传输到电脑。

三、ADB的高级用法

  • 远程调试:通过无线方式连接ADB设备,无需USB线即可进行调试。
  • 模拟输入:使用“adb shell input”命令模拟用户输入,如点击、滑动等。
  • 性能监控:使用“adb shell dumpsys”命令查看系统性能信息。
  • 截图与录屏:使用“adb shell screencap”命令截图,或使用第三方工具进行录屏。

四、ADB在实际开发中的应用

在实际开发中,ADB工具与千帆大模型开发与服务平台等开发工具的结合使用,可以大大提高开发效率。例如,开发者可以利用ADB工具快速部署和调试应用,同时结合千帆大模型开发与服务平台提供的强大功能,进行模型训练、部署和监控,从而打造更加出色的Android应用。

五、总结

ADB是一个功能强大且灵活的工具,它能够帮助开发者高效地进行Android应用的开发和调试工作。通过本文的介绍,相信读者已经掌握了ADB的下载安装及使用方法,并能够在实际开发中灵活运用这一工具。同时,也建议开发者不断探索ADB的高级用法和与其他开发工具的结合使用,以进一步提升开发效率和质量。

article bottom image

相关文章推荐

发表评论